    It's a legal play and a fumble could occur. That being said, The Giants were on the ing TB 30 with a couple secs left--even if they recover the fumble they'll have either no time on the clock, or time for one play from 70 yards out.

    Colin Cowherd of all people said it best: Nothing wrong with it, but Schiano wasted his one opportunity on a hopeless endeavor. He should've tried it when teams had to do one or 2 kneel downs in their own territory. Now everybody will be looking for it.
